Indian hand carved model depicting the famous Lion Capital of Ashoka, the captial was erected by the Mauryan Emperor Ashoka in Sarnath, India, around 250 BCE, and features four Asiatic lions standing back-to-back symbolising power, courage, confidence and pride, the lions are mounted on a circular base with ashoka chakras around the side, this model set on a tiered round wood base. Dimensions: Carving measures 1.5 inches H, on stand measures 3 inches.
